DESCRIPTION

S1F71100 is a pulse width modulation (PWM) type
step-down DC/DC converter control IC for which the
CMOS process is used and to which a power transistor
is connected outside. S1F71100 is composed of an os-
cillator, a reference voltage circuit, an error amplifier, a
PWM circuit, a soft start circuit, a driver, etc. When this
IC drives an external P ch power MOS transistor,
S1F71100 can constitute a step-down DC/DC converter
that converts input voltages up to 12V into the output
voltage of 3.3V.
S1F71100 is also provided with a low-voltage protec-
tion circuit, an overcurrent protection circuit and a soft
start protection circuit. When receiving external sig-
nals, S1F71100 can stop the oscillator and the switching
circuit and turn off the power, so that it can reduce
wasteful current consumption at the time of system halt.

FEATURES

• Input voltage : 3.3V ~ 12V
• Output voltage : 3.3V (S1F71100M0A0)
• Power off current : 1

µ

A

• Self current consumption : 800

µ

A

• Frequency fixing (200kHz) PWM
• Power off function (IC shutdown)
• Soft start function
• Overcurrent protection function
• Low-voltage protection function
• Shipping pattern : plastic package SOP4-8pin
* Radiation-resistant design has not been provided for

this specification.
